Hydra - Le Bottin des Jeux Linux

Hydra

🗃️ Specifications

📰 Title: Hydra 🕹️ / 🛠️ Type: Tool
🗃️ Genre: Emulation 🚦 Status: 02. In dev. (no status)
🏷️ Category: Emulation ➤ Engine ➤ Multi 🌍️ Browser version:
🔖 Tags: Game Launcher; Framework; Emulation; Multi Emulation; Hydra compatible 📦️ Package Name:
🐣️ Approx. start: 2021-03-28 📦️ Arch package:
🐓️ Latest: 2023-10-21 📦️ RPM package:
📍️ Version: Latest: - / Dev: 074d945 📦️ Deb package:
🏛️ License type: 🕊️ Libre 📦️ Flatpak package:
🏛️ License: GPL-3 📦️ AppImage package:
🏝️ Perspective: First person (interface) 📦️ Snap package:
👁️ Visual: 2D ⚙️ Generic binary:
⏱️ Pacing: Real Time 📄️ Source: ✓
👫️ Played: Single 📱️ PDA support: ✓
🎖️ This record: 5 stars 🕳️ Not used:
🎀️ Game design: 👫️ Contrib.: goupildb
🎰️ ID: 16361 🐛️ Created: 2023-10-21
🐜️ Updated: 2023-10-30

📖️ Summary

[en]: A libre, multi-platform interface (under development) for emulator cores (in the style of Libretro). A Hydra core is a shared library that defines functions in the core header. Users load cores by placing them in the core directory specified in Hydra's parameters. To date (202310), 2 cores are available (and under development): SkyEmu (Gameboy/Gameboy Color, Gameboy Advance, Nintendo DS) and Panda3DS (Nintendo 3DS), with others (vargds for the Nintendo DS, and n64hydra for the Nintendo 64) also planned but not given priority. [fr]: Une interface libre et multi-plateforme (en développement) pour cœurs d'émulateurs (à la manière de Libretro). Un coeur Hydra est une bibliothèque partagée qui définit les fonctions dans l'en-tête du coeur. L'utilisateur charge les cœurs en les plaçant dans le répertoire core spécifié dans les paramètres de Hydra. A ce jour (202310), 2 coeurs sont disponibles (et en développement) : SkyEmu (Gameboy/Gameboy Color, Gameboy Advance, Nintendo DS) et Panda3DS (Nintendo 3DS), d'autres (vargds pour la Nintendo DS, et n64hydra pour la Nintendo 64) sont aussi prévus mais non prioritaires.

🚦 Entry status

💡 Lights on: 🦺️ Work in progress:
📰 What's new?: 💥️ New New version published (to be updated):
🎨️ Significant improvement: 🚧️ Some work remains to be done:
🕳️ Not used2: 👔️ Already shown:

🎥️ Videos


📰 Progress: (202310),

🕸️ Links

🏡️ Website & videos
[Homepage] [Dev site] [Features/About] [Screenshots] [Videos cv(202310) t(202xxx) gd(202xxx) gu(202xxx) r(202xxx) lp(202xxx) ht(202xxx) g(202xxx) g[fr](202xxx) g[de](202xxx) g[ru](202xxx) g[pl](202xxx) g[cz](202xxx) g[sp](202xxx) g[pt](202xxx) g[it](202xxx) g[tr](202xxx)] [WIKI] [FAQ] [RSS: waiting] [Changelog 1 2 3]

💰 Commercial: (empty)

🍩️ Resources
Current cores
• Panda3DS (an HLE, red-panda-themed Nintendo 3DS emulator written in C++, GPL-3): [Homepage] [Dev site] [Discord] 🎬️ht(202309) d(202308) d(202303)
• SkyEmu (a low level GameBoy, GameBoy Color, Game Boy Advance, and Nintendo DS emulator, MIT): [Homepage] [Dev site] [Discord] 🎬️gu(202308) ht[pt](202306) d(202206)

🛠️ Technical informations
[PCGamingWiki] [MobyGames]

🐘 Social
Devs (Hydra Team 1 2 [fr] [en]): [Site 1 2] [Chat] [mastodon] [PeerTube] [YouTube] [PressKit] [Interview 1(202xxx) 2(202xxx)]
Devs (Paris (OFFTKP 1) 2 [fr] [en]): [Site 1 2] [Chat] [mastodon] [PeerTube] [YouTube] [PressKit] [Interview 1(202xxx) 2(202xxx)]
The Project: [Blog] [Chat] [Forums] [mastodon] [PeerTube] [YouTube] [PressKit] [Lemmy] [reddit] [Discord]

🐝️ Related


📦️ Misc. repositories
[Repology] [pkgs.org] [Arch Linux / AUR] [openSUSE] [Debian/Ubuntu] [Flatpak] [AppImage (author's repo)] [Snap] [PortableLinuxGames]

🕵️ Reviews
[HowLongToBeat] [metacritic] [OpenCritic] [iGDB]

🕊️ Source of this Entry: [Mr Sujano on YouTube (202310)]

🐘 Social Networking Update (on mastodon)

🛠️ Title: Hydra
🦊️ What's: A libre, multi-platform interface (under dev) for emulator cores (similar to Libretro)
🏡️ -
🐣️ https://github.com/hydra-emu
🔖 #LinuxEmulation #Framework #Plugins
📦️ #Libre
📖 Our entry: http://www.lebottindesjeuxlinux.tuxfamily.org/en/online/lights-on/

🥁️ Update: (waiting)
⚗️ -
📌️ Changes: https://github.com/hydra-emu/hydra/releases
🐘 From: https://www.youtube.com/embed/lUNLMNpOow4?start=202
📶️ -
📰 https://www.youtube.com/embed/lUNLMNpOow4?start=202

🕶️ A view of his IU with the Super Mario 64 game. At the top of the UI the menu (File, Emulation, Tools, Help), on the rest of the UI the emulated game.

Hydra is a libre, multi-platform interface (under development) for emulator cores (in the style of Libretro). A Hydra core is a shared library that defines functions in the core header. Users load cores by placing them in the core directory specified in Hydra's parameters. To date (202310), 2 cores are available (and under development): SkyEmu (Gameboy/Gameboy Color, Gameboy Advance, Nintendo DS) and Panda3DS (Nintendo 3DS), with others (vargds for the Nintendo DS, and n64hydra for the Nintendo 64) also planned but not given priority.

📕 Description [en]

📕🐧"A libre, multi-platform interface (under development) for emulator cores (similar to Libretro)."🐧📕

Cross-platform GameBoy, NES, N64 and Chip-8 emulator

⚠️ This project is very early in development and not ready for use yet! ⚠️

What is this?

This is Hydra, a multi-platform frontend for emulator cores. A Hydra core is a shared library that defines the functions in the core header. You can load cores by placing them in the core directory specified in Hydras settings.

Current cores

⭐ indicates a preference, 🚧 indicates a core that is early in development

Gameboy/Gameboy Color
• SkyEmu ⭐

Gameboy Advance
• SkyEmu ⭐

Nintendo DS
• SkyEmu ⭐
• vargds 🚧

Nintendo 3DS
• Panda3DS ⭐

Nintendo 64
• n64hydra 🚧

📕 Description [fr]

, par l'Hydra Team, initié par Paris (OFFTKP 1).

Hydra est une interface libre et multi-plateforme (en développement) pour cœurs d'émulateurs (à la manière de Libretro). Un coeur Hydra est une bibliothèque partagée qui définit les fonctions dans l'en-tête du coeur. L'utilisateur charge les cœurs en les plaçant dans le répertoire core spécifié dans les paramètres de Hydra. A ce jour (202310), 2 coeurs sont disponibles (et en développement) : SkyEmu (Gameboy/Gameboy Color, Gameboy Advance, Nintendo DS) et Panda3DS (Nintendo 3DS), d'autres (vargds pour la Nintendo DS, et n64hydra pour la Nintendo 64) sont aussi prévus mais non prioritaires.


Emulateur multiplateforme GameBoy, NES, N64 et Chip-8

⚠️ Ce projet est très peu avancé et n'est pas encore prêt à être utilisé ! ⚠️

Qu'est-ce que c'est ?

Il s'agit de Hydra, un frontal multi-plateforme pour cœurs d'émulateurs. Un coeur Hydra est une bibliothèque partagée qui définit les fonctions dans l'en-tête du coeur. Vous pouvez charger les cœurs en les plaçant dans le répertoire core spécifié dans les paramètres de Hydra.

Coeurs actuels

⭐ indique une préférence, 🚧 indique un noyau en début de développement

Gameboy/Gameboy Color
• SkyEmu ⭐

Gameboy Advance
• SkyEmu ⭐

Nintendo DS
• SkyEmu ⭐
• vargds 🚧

Nintendo 3DS
• Panda3DS ⭐

Nintendo 64
• n64hydra 🚧